1. The Architecture of Alienation

The 13th arrondissement is dominated by the Olympiades, a set of 1970s tower blocks. Unlike the romantic winding streets of the Left Bank, this district is all right angles, concrete, and glass. Audiard shoots these spaces in crisp, high-contrast black and white, stripping away the romantic color usually associated with Paris. The characters—Émilie, Camille, Nora, and Amber—move through these spaces like electrons orbiting a nucleus they cannot find. The geometry of the buildings mirrors the geometry of their relationships: casual hookups, misread texts, flatmate arrangements that turn sexual, and friendships that dissolve without closure. WEBRip: Understanding the Piracy Tag

The term WEBRip (or WEB-Rip) is a piracy classification. It means the video was captured (ripped) from a streaming web source—often MUBI, Amazon Prime, or Apple TV+—and then re-encoded to a smaller file size.

The Film’s 2021 Release: Context and Reception

2021 was a strange year for cinema. The COVID-19 pandemic was still disrupting global releases, and many films debuted on streaming or hybrid platforms. Paris, 13th District premiered at the Cannes Film Festival (July 2021) in competition for the Palme d’Or. It later opened theatrically in France (November 2021) and internationally through MUBI (the curated streaming service).
